On the other hand, 2FA opens up the "I lost my phone" customer support channel which might be just as weak. For example, you can turn on 2FA for sending money via Bank of America's webpanel. As in, you log in with username/password and need 2FA for some restricted actions. Well, phone up customer support and they'll remove your 2FA if you can provide them some secret details... all of which are displayed on the webpa…
> On the other hand, 2FA opens up the "I lost my phone" customer support channel which might be just as weak. "I lost my phone" (or "my phone stopped working") does need some solution, though. The right way to handle "I lost my phone" seems like one of two possibilities: either come into a branch and provide legal identification matching what you used to open the account (and get "yourself" on camera doing so), or ha…
You provide a scanned copy of a government-issued photo ID.
You provide a scanned copy of a statement showing both the most recent deposit and a name and address matching one of your accounts.
You complete SMS verification. (SMS must be previously configured.)
You complete 2-factor verification. (2-factor auth must be previously configured.)
You correctly answer your security question. (Security question and answer must be previously configured, below.)
You use an ssh key to create a file with a specific name on one of your sites hosted here. (Must be previously configured, won’t work if account is empty.)
We try and fail to contact you via your currently configured email address. (This one may take a long time.)
You can then pick how many of these you want to require to get your account back (and which you want to configure), including an option not to help at all in the case you lose your account.Re: Amazon's customer service backdoor

#57> services should allow me to easily create lots of aliases. Right now the best defense against social engineering seems to be my fastmail account which allows me to create 1 email address alias per service What you may want is a catch-all email - which lets you do @domain.com -> nmjohn@domain.com (where is everything besides already defined addresses) - that way you can make up emails on the fly without having to se…
Note, though, that catch-all emails will also catch a ridiculous amount of spam. Creating each account name individually avoids that problem, at the cost of some extra trouble when registering a new service. An intermediate step that may work if you don't expect people to target you individually: have one or more required substrings for the email local part, and catch all mail to addresses containing that substring.

#58> services should allow me to easily create lots of aliases. Right now the best defense against social engineering seems to be my fastmail account which allows me to create 1 email address alias per service What you may want is a catch-all email - which lets you do @domain.com -> nmjohn@domain.com (where is everything besides already defined addresses) - that way you can make up emails on the fly without having to se…
Fastmail and Gmail support a local suffix of the form yourname+amazon@gmail.com. That's a plus character between the local name and local suffix. If you use a password manager, you can replace a predictable suffix like "amazon" with random hex value. Unfortunately, many sites borked their e-mail address validation and do not accept the plus character. (Amazon permits it.) Also, you'll ocassionally find a customer ser…
